2.6 million collected in one day from traffic fines

Kathmandu, May 7

The Kathmandu Valley in the past 24 hours recorded 2,015 cases of traffic violations. Revenue of Rs 2.66 million has been collected as fines from the violators of traffic rules.

According to the Kathmandu Valley Traffic Police, such cases include 99 of drunk-driving, 193 of ride-sharing against the rule, 133 of the violation of traffic signals and 132 of breaching lane discipline.

Likewise, 79 cases are related to honking in prohibited areas, 87 of parking on roadsides and pavements, 139 of over-speed driving, 79 for driving on a one-way route and 1,164 of other traffic-related violations
